MALAWI: President Professor Arthur Peter Mutharika Appointed Honorary Patron of Peace Parks Foundation
By Smile Hamilton Malawi
President Professor Arthur Peter Mutharika has been appointed Honorary Patron of the Peace Parks Foundation, a non-profit organisation dedicated to the creation and management of transfrontier conservation areas across Africa.
In a statement signed by Chief Secretary Justin Saidi, the appointment was described as recognition of President Mutharika’s distinguished leadership and unwavering commitment to sustainable development, regional cooperation, and ecological resilience.
The statement further noted that the honour was conferred by the former President of Mozambique and Chairperson of the Foundation, Joaquim Alberto Chissano.
The Peace Parks Foundation works closely with governments, conservation agencies, and local communities to promote biodiversity protection, eco-tourism development, and cross-border environmental cooperation. President Mutharika’s appointment is expected to strengthen Malawi’s role in regional conservation efforts and enhance collaboration in the sustainable management of shared natural resources.
